Soyuz TMA-12M
Crew:
Aleksandr Skvortsov [2], Commander
Oleg Artemyev [1], Flight Engineer
Steven Swanson [3], Flight Engineer (USA)
Backup Crew:
Aleksandr Samokutyayev
(for Skvortsov)
Elena Serova
(for Artemyev)
Barry Wilmore (USA)
(for Swanson)
Launch:
Location: Baikonur, Site 1/5
Date: 25 March 2014
Time: 21:17:23 UTC
Landing:
Date: 11 September 2014
Time: 02:23:00 UTC
Location: 47° 18.7' N, 69° 33.3' E
Docking:
Poisk , 27 March 2014 23:53 UTC - 10 September 2014 23:02 UTC
Duration: 169 days, 5 hours, 5 minutes, 37 seconds
Call Sign: Utyos (Cliff)
